Location: Wabasca-Desmarais
Bigstone Health Commission is seeking dedicated Shelter Support Workers to help foster a respectful and safe environment for those experiencing homelessness. Your support will be vital in ensuring dignity and comfort in our shelter.
In this role, you will assist with client intake, provide crisis intervention, and maintain a clean, safe space for residents. Strong interpersonal and problem-solving skills are crucial to support our trauma-informed approach, ensuring all individuals receive the assistance they need, while keeping accurate documentation of situations and services.
Key Responsibilities:
• Ensure safety and well-being of all residents
• Conduct client intake and facilitate sleeping arrangements
• Provide crisis intervention and support
• Distribute meals and perform housekeeping tasks
• Maintain client documentation and incident reports
Requirements:
• Grade 12 education or equivalent preferred
• Experience in shelters or outreach settings is an asset
• Knowledge of trauma-informed practices required
• Certifications in First Aid/CPR and NVCI preferred
• Willingness to work rotating shifts
